Market Context

CN Energy (CNEY) has seen modest upward movement in recent trading sessions, with the stock hovering near $0.76—a fraction above its established support level of $0.72. The +0.32% gain reflects cautious buying interest, though volume remains slightly below the stock's historical average, suggesting that conviction is still building rather than surging. Resistance at $0.80 is a key near-term threshold; a sustained push above that level could signal a shift in momentum. Within the broader renewable energy sector, CNEY occupies a niche position as a small-cap player focused on biomass-based energy solutions. Recent sector-wide tailwinds—including policy support for clean energy initiatives and rising feedstock prices—have drawn incremental attention to companies along the supply chain. However, CNEY's limited liquidity and sparse analyst coverage amplify volatility, making price action particularly sensitive to broader risk sentiment. What appears to be driving the stock is a combination of speculative positioning ahead of any potential catalysts and technical stabilization after earlier downward pressure. While no recent earnings data or major corporate announcements have surfaced, the stock's ability to hold above $0.72 may encourage short-term participants to test the upper end of the range. Continued low volume, though, could cap decisive breakout attempts unless broader market conditions shift materially. Technical Analysis

CN Energy (CNEY) currently trades at $0.76, hovering near its established support of $0.72 and just below the $0.80 resistance zone. The stock has been consolidating within this narrow range in recent weeks, suggesting a period of indecision among market participants. The price action shows a series of lower highs since the beginning of the second quarter, which may indicate a short-term downtrend, although the proximity to support could lead to a potential bounce. Technical indicators point to oversold conditions on the daily chart, with the Relative Strength Index (RSI) in oversold territory, hinting at a possible relief rally. Meanwhile, trading volume has remained relatively subdued, implying a lack of strong conviction from either bulls or bears. The stock is also trading below its short-term moving averages, signaling a bearish bias; however, a move above the $0.80 resistance could change the near-term outlook. If CNEY holds above $0.72, a test of the $0.80 level appears plausible. Conversely, a breakdown below support would likely target lower levels, potentially opening the path toward the $0.65 area. Traders may watch for a decisive close above resistance or a failure at support to gauge the next directional move. Outlook

Looking ahead, CN Energy’s near-term trajectory hinges on its ability to hold the $0.72 support level, which has recently provided a floor. A sustained defense of this zone could open a path toward the $0.80 resistance, where selling pressure has historically emerged. Conversely, a decisive break below $0.72 may invite further downside, potentially testing lower liquidity zones. The current price action near $0.76 places the stock in a neutral-to-bullish posture, but momentum appears subdued given the modest daily gain. Several factors could influence future performance. Broader sector sentiment—particularly around renewable energy and biomass industries—may offer tailwinds if regulatory or policy developments favor alternative energy providers. Company-specific updates, such as operational milestones or partnership announcements, would likely be catalysts for a move above resistance. However, without recent earnings data available, near-term visibility remains limited. Traders may watch volume patterns for confirmation; a pickup in activity on an upward move could validate a breakout attempt. Alternatively, if volume remains lackluster, the stock might consolidate within the current range. As always, external macroeconomic conditions or shifts in risk appetite could alter the risk-reward profile, so caution is warranted at these levels.
